Residents of S2 3YH enjoy convenient access to various amenities within practical reach. Five metro stops are nearby, including Park Grange, Arbourthorne Rd to Halfway, and Arbourthorne Road. You can travel through these stations easily to reach further destinations. For shopping needs, five retail outlets serve the immediate area. Notable names include Co-op Gleadless, Asda Sheffield, and Heron Arbourthorne. These venues offer standard groceries and everyday essentials without the need for extensive travel. Rail connectivity provides three major stations close by: Sheffield Railway Station, Darnall Railway Station, and Dore & Totley Railway Station. Access to Sheffield Railway Station offers direct links into the city centre or national network. Daily life benefits from this proximity to retail and transport hubs. Families considering schools near S2 3YH will find three specific educational institutions in the immediate vicinity. East Hill Secondary School is registered as a special school, catering to students with specific educational needs. East Hill Primary School also operates as a special school, serving the younger years within the same framework. Kirkhill School completes the local provision as another special school.
